As far as telkom internet is concerned I've seen the following definitions floating around their site

What is Blended bandwidth?
Blended bandwidth is international and local bandwidth combined.

What is Local Only bandwidth?
Local only applies to servers that are hosted in South Africa. Please remember that this is not to say that .co.za is a local hosted server because anyone can purchase such a domain. TelkomInternet will suggest contacting the specific web master of that website to find out if their server is locally hosted.
